We are proud to have the largest collection of paintings by artist Sandro Negri outside his studio in Mantova, Italy. Sandro lives, works and paints daily in the restored, medieval Palazzo Cavalcabó. We are honored to exhibit the work of such a prolific artist. The work of Sandro Negri is constantly on display in one of our four show rooms, and is rotated regularly.

Join me on Saturday May 10th to meet Sandro Negri who is joining us from his home in Italy to launch his new work, Segreti. These traditional rural oil paintings are designed on old window shutters and have panels that open and close, representing a new direction for this prolific artist. Most panels have a small painting on the outside and, when open, reveal a triptych of an opulent pastoral scene or bright, beautiful landscape, for which Sandro is known.
